Notes
The upsides of the preseason game:
- The defense was able to create pressure and turnovers for the second straight game.
- Quarterback Athan Kaliakmanis looks much more comfortable in this offense than Sam Hartman.
The downsides of the preseason game:
- The offensive line with Jayden Daniels at quarterback did not look good giving up pressure on all three plays, including a sack.
- The defense gave up too much yardage on run plays, including a 50-yard touchdown run by Joshua Dobbs, where several players were out of position.
This week saw a number of injuries pile up and keep over 15 players out of the Lions game. The biggest injury being to Newton who had potentially season-ending surgery.
The offensive line issues increase concerns about how well will the offense perform to start the season. The front offense may have to trade for a better center if Nick Allegretti cannot make it to the field. Julian Good-Jones and Matt Gulbin are not the answer at center for week 1.
Two players who most likely only have a shot at the practice squad, Jaden Bradley and Nick Nash, led the receiving group in this game. Both has nice catches on deep throws, Bradley for 30 yards and Nash for 55 yards.
Antonio Williams continues to look like the real deal with 3 catches on 3 targets for 41 yards. Jacoby Jones also had 2 catches on 2 targets. Problem is the team has a logjam at wide receiver behind Terry McLaurin, Stefon Diggs and Williams who are the locks at this point. The big question will be how many wide receivers and tight ends Washington keeps on the 53-man roster.
The defense has shown promise even without several starters on the field. It looks like the hiring of Daronte Jones was the right move. He put players in position to succeed in his defense.
